Transaction 17e166c18fa95ce4c1905a9e020d6d81449b598dfd15273e2fe62d4208bfec84

1 Input
2 Outputs
  • 17e166c18fa95ce4c1905a9e020d6d81449b598dfd15273e2fe62d4208bfec84:0
  • value  444184762
    address  1MaUVgXCgdXLkmXwQ4WDek5yaK86zYXw2q
  • 17e166c18fa95ce4c1905a9e020d6d81449b598dfd15273e2fe62d4208bfec84:1
  • value  4000000
    address  35nPHmcJaC4MsCBGSBiXVduFYXXtt71SuT